The Importance of Green Spaces

Green spaces, such as parks, community gardens, and urban forests, serve as hubs for social interaction, physical activity, and relaxation. These areas offer a retreat from the hustle and bustle of city life, promoting mental well-being and environmental sustainability.

Benefits of Public Planting Projects

Public planting projects involve the collaborative effort of local authorities, community organizations, and volunteers to plant trees, flowers, and other vegetation in public spaces. These initiatives bring several advantages:

  • Improving air quality by absorbing pollutants and releasing oxygen
  • Enhancing aesthetic appeal and creating attractive landscapes
  • Providing habitat for wildlife, supporting biodiversity
  • Reducing urban heat island effect through shading and cooling
  • Encouraging community involvement and pride in shared spaces
